Because Embedded is More Than Software

The entire system is considered – from the first line of code to the hardware.

For simple requirements, we design our own circuit boards & prototypes; for complex hardware, we work closely with ANDAV Electronics GmbH.

This integration reduces hardware costs, optimizes system architecture, and improves the interaction of all components.

  • Reduced hardware costs through optimized designs
  • Clean integration between software and hardware
  • Higher quality prototypes and production units
  • Shorter development cycles through parallel development
